I was a visiting Title member from another club out of state and I was excited to experience another Title while on vacation to see how it compared. I brought my sister along with me who had never been to a Title class and I was hoping she would love it just like me. We hit traffic prior to the noon 60 min class so we were going to be arriving shortly before the start of class. I apologized for not arriving sooner but we told our trainer was “always late” so that’s ok. (I’ll give the trainer’s name if needed) Hearing this when walking in the door was already not good. He arrived to class 5-10 minutes late. His microphone only worked or was on for 10% of the class. I never realized he started the warm up because he spent 99% of it walking around and talking to everyone (small talk). I have never spent 2-3 minutes doing strictly high knees before this class. Next the 8 rounds of boxing had no variety. We repeated several sequences multiple times. He was very nit picky about my stance, how far my feet were apart, how I would pivot on my back foot, EVERYTHING. He was not critiquing in a professional way. He was rude and I felt frustrated by his lack of training. There were several times we spent the majority of a round doing the same movement because he was over someone trying to get them to perform a movement exactly the way he wanted. The only time he eased up on me was when I said I belonged to a Title club already. Next...12 minutes of “core” was not good. We spent the majority of the time doing standard crunch, crunch holds, and bicycles. I was thankful when the class ended and felt embarrassed that my sister was with me and had to witness that type of training during a class. I hope that all trainers at this location are not trained like this because he definitely did not have any professionalism nor show any respect for Title Boxing by his actions.
